Layout and Space Use


One of the first decisions is how you want to use the space. Are you sticking with the existing layout, or are you thinking of moving plumbing fixtures like the toilet, shower, or sink? While moving fixtures can offer better functionality, it can also increase costs. A good rule of thumb is to maximize the current layout unless it’s necessary to rearrange things to improve flow or access.

Bathtub or Shower?


Deciding between a bathtub, a shower, or both is another major choice. If you’re limited on space, a sleek walk-in shower might be the best option. If you love soaking in a tub, a freestanding or built-in tub could add a spa-like vibe to your bathroom. Consider your daily routines, and don’t forget to think about resale value—some buyers prefer homes with at least one bathtub.


Fixtures and Finishes


The style and finish of your bathroom fixtures—such as faucets, showerheads, and cabinet hardware—can have a huge impact on the overall look of the room. Do you prefer modern, minimalist fixtures, or are you leaning toward more traditional, vintage styles? Finishes like chrome, brushed nickel, or matte black all create different aesthetics, so this is your chance to choose fixtures that reflect your style.


Flooring and Wall Materials


Your choice of flooring and wall materials should blend style with practicality. Tile is one of the most popular options for bathrooms because it’s durable and water-resistant, but you’ll need to decide between different types, like ceramic, porcelain, or natural stone. Consider slip resistance, especially in a bathroom that might get wet frequently, and choose a material that’s both safe and easy to maintain.


Storage Solutions


Adequate storage is a must in any bathroom. You’ll need to think about how much storage you need and where it will fit best. Floating vanities, built-in shelving, and recessed medicine cabinets are great space-saving options. You might also want to consider custom cabinetry to meet specific storage needs, especially in smaller or irregularly shaped bathrooms.
